Take your knowledge of Chinese to the next plane! Chinese 3D teaches you the most common Chinese words in a beautiful 3D landscape that is designed to be easily viewed, navigated and fun to explore. Learn with an engaging visualization of the psychologically best established learning method.

Video: http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=lvwkFSkngTk

Features:

- Based on the Spaced Repetition learning method, one of the psychologically best established and efficient memorization techniques.
- Learn the meaning and pronunciation of the 1200 words from HSK levels 1 to 4. The HSK is the most widely used test of Chinese as a foreign language.
- All words have audio playback, pronounced by native speakers.
- On the new iPad, high resolution is fully supported.
- Teaches simplified characters, the official writing system in Mainland China.
- Teaches Mandarin Chinese pronunciation, the most widely used pronunciation for Chinese.

Most immersive flash card system
The design and presentation of this app is what sets it apart. From the opening sequence of the tutorial, which fades in to a close up of the flash card 中国 and pans out to a vast landscape of cards formed into towers. The metaphor is fresh and invokes a feeling of immersion in the history and beauty of the language. Small and subtle choices in the interface make a big impact. Checking the English definition of a word by tapping on its marble slab evokes an animation of the slab sliding up to reveal the information, accompanied by the crisp sound of stone sliding on stone. Rendering the terrain slightly concave instead of flat puts me in the mind of filling a bowl with measurable amounts of progress on a project that, though long, is still completely possible. I love this tool and it is allowing me to study harder and longer, as if I were absorbed in a video game, rather than studying Chinese.
